Gritty Giants Heap More Misery on Battling Bombers

Date:

Brent Daniels of the Giants (centre) celebrates with teammates after kicking a goal during the AFL Round 9 match between the GWS Giants and the Essendon Bombers at ENGIE Stadium in Sydney on May 9, 2026. AAP Image/Dan HimbrechtsGWS coach Adam Kingsley says he never doubted as an injury-hit Giants outfit dug deep to seal a gutsy 14-point comeback win over Essendon.Trailing by two points at the final break, the Giants slammed through five goals to two to set up a 16.7 (103) to 13.11 (89) victory at ENGIE Stadium on Saturday.
